Family Guidance Centers Inc in Chicago, IL, delivers thorough substance use recovery services for adults and adolescents. Available programs include standard outpatient care, as well as specialized services utilizing methadone, buprenorphine, or naltrexone. The center employs therapeutic techniques such as cognitive behavioral therapy, motivational interviewing, and relapse prevention. Emphasizing personalized support, Family Guidance Centers Inc crafts treatment paths to suit individual client circumstances. They serve both men and women, fostering a welcoming atmosphere.
